Arson

At about 4.30 this morning a patrol of the Guardia Civil noticed smoke and flames coming from Mi Sol Bar, and called the Fire Brigade, who in due course extinguished the fire.

It would appear, from information available, that someone gained access to the Bar Terrace by use of a key, as the chain and lock were found undamaged on the Terrace. Entry to the Bar appears to have been by lifting one of the steel window shutters. A cash till which had contained only small change was found smashed on the terrace, nothing else seems to have been taken. A fire was then started near the coffee machine in the Bar serving area.

The Bar serving area, including the electrical wiring, appears almost totally destroyed, the Bar seating area has smoke and water damage.

The Bar is closed until further notice, likely to be at least several weeks.
The Guardia Civil, and the Insurance company have begun their enquiries into who might have perpetrated this crime.

As is normal when something like this happens, much speculation and rumour abounds about who did it and why. We shall have to await the reports from the Police and the Insurance Company.

Not only have the Community been deprived of their social facilities, but of course several people have also lost their jobs because of this. Not least the very fine Chef who has been providing excellent food over the past months.

The Bar tenant, Mr Morans, is away in Thailand for about three months, and so far no one has managed to contact him.
